When to Plant Fall Grass Seed

Fall is the perfect time to plant grass seed for a lush and green lawn in the spring. However, knowing the right time to plant your fall grass seed is crucial to its success. In this article, we will discuss when to plant fall grass seed and what factors to consider before seeding.

Factors to Consider Before Seeding

Before you start planting fall grass seed, there are a few factors to consider that can have a significant impact on the success of your lawn.

Soil Temperature and Moisture: The soil temperature and moisture are crucial for the grass seed to germinate. Ideally, the soil temperature should be between 50 and 65 degrees Fahrenheit, and the soil should be moist but not waterlogged.

Grass Type: The type of grass you want to plant will also determine the best time to seed. Cool-season grasses, such as fescue and bluegrass, are best seeded in the fall. Warm-season grasses, such as Bermuda and Zoysia, are best seeded in the spring or early summer.

Climate: The climate in your area can also affect when to plant fall grass seed. If you live in a region with warm summers and cool winters, fall is the best time to seed. If you live in a region with hot summers and mild winters, spring may be the best time to seed.

When to Plant Fall Grass Seed

Now that you know the factors to consider when planting fall grass seed, let's discuss the best time to seed.

Cool-Season Grasses: If you are planting cool-season grasses, the best time to seed is in late summer or early fall. The soil is still warm enough for the grass seed to germinate, and the cooler temperatures will allow the grass to establish itself before winter.

Warm-Season Grasses: If you are planting warm-season grasses, the best time to seed is in the spring or early summer. These grasses need warm temperatures to germinate and establish themselves before the cooler temperatures in the fall and winter.

Tips for Planting Fall Grass Seed

Here are some tips to help you successfully plant fall grass seed:

Prepare the Soil: Before seeding, prepare the soil by removing any debris, rocks, or weeds. You can also loosen the soil with a rake or tiller to create a seedbed.

Select the Right Seed: Choose a grass seed that is appropriate for your climate and soil type. You can also choose a seed blend or mix to ensure optimal growth and coverage.

Seed at the Right Rate: Be sure to follow the recommended seeding rate for your chosen grass seed.

Water Properly: Once the seed is planted, it is essential to water it regularly until it is established. Be sure to water deeply but avoid overwatering.
